C. Comfort with the AR platform

Augmented Reality is more than just adding visual elements to an application. It is also about understanding how a user’s environment affects their ability to engage with your app. As such, it is important to hire developers who are comfortable with the AR platform you plan to use. For example, if you plan to build a mobile AR app, make sure your developer is familiar with ARKit and ARCore. If you plan to build a web-based AR experience, make sure your developer is familiar with WebAR. Hiring developers who are already familiar with the platform you plan to use will make it easier to get your project started. It will also help ensure that your app is built in a way that maximizes the functionality of the platform.

D. Communication and collaboration skills

Communication and collaboration skills are important for any developer, but are especially critical for AR programmers. For one, AR developers need to communicate with stakeholders to understand their requirements and help them visualize how their app will look in their environment. AR devs will also need to collaborate with other developers to create their app. Communication and collaboration skills are important because they determine how easily your team members collaborate and how effectively they communicate with one another. Look for developers who come from a collaborative and open culture. This will help ensure that your team members work well together and that they understand each other’s work. Collaborative and open team members are also more likely to speak up if something is going wrong or if they need help understanding something. This can help your team avoid common pitfalls and deliver a better product.

Examples of AR developers

Augmented Reality developers can come from a wide variety of backgrounds, which makes it difficult to describe what someone in this field would look like. Some AR devs come from computer science or engineering backgrounds, while others come from creative fields like graphic design or marketing. Some developers come from a mix of these fields, while others come from completely different industries. Regardless of their background, there are some examples of AR developers that you can look to for inspiration and ideas. First, there are AR engineers. AR engineers are developers who specialize in building AR applications. This can include building mobile AR apps or building web-based AR experiences. AR engineers will likely have a computer science or engineering background, and will have a significant amount of experience building AR applications. Next, there are AR designers. AR designers are a relatively new field that combines design and AR to help businesses solve problems. AR designers will likely have a creative background, such as a graphic design or marketing background, although it is possible for them to come from fields like architecture or engineering. AR designers will have a solid understanding of design and of AR and will be able to create beautiful and functional apps.
